South-to-North Water Diversion Project - Hutuohe Inverted Siphon

In 2004,Sanbo contracted to undertake the Fully Automatic Hydraulic Liner Trolley for Hutuohe Inverted Siphon Project of the South-to-North Water Diversion Project-one of the state’s key projects. Hutuohe Inverted Siphon Project is situated in Zhengding County,Hebei Province,which is the first project to be kicked off in the Jing-Shi Section of the South-to-North Water Diversion Emergency Water Supply Project. The inverted siphon pipe adopts three-hole one-connection reinforcement concrete box type construction. Project use of the liner trolley has proven that fully automatic hydraulic liner trolley is featured by good grouting quality,quick formwork installation and removal,good results,easy operation and high degree of safety and reliabilty. Use of this product has overcome shortcomings of traditional formwork grouting,thus bringing about another major breakthrough and leap in concrete construction technology.

launching girder

Donghai Sea Bridge is composed of two big-span cable-stayed bridges, four pre-stressed continuous beam bridges, lots of approach bridges and a bank between 2 islands.

Unlike bridge erection machines used in other projects in the past ,which were used just to place the prefabricated beams on the bridge ,the launching girder used for this project has formworks inside to allow for rebar bundling  and concrete pouring and ramming .Furthermore ,800T launching girder can also walk automatically to build the bridge structure concrete .This is the first time to in China in supplication of the builder technology and it is also the rare case all over the world.

Zhou shan Project---Automatic hydraulic internal model of 60m box girders developed by Sanbo specially for 60m box girders is a new internal model system. The automatic hydraulic control internal model can expend and shrink, designed to move in overall, out separately, and the shrinkage rate of the internal model is 56.4%. The internal model consists of standard section and variable cross section, two sections and 12 sub-sections. Hydraulic drive can reduce the labor intensity, shorten the time of work, and improve efficiency.

On November 27th,2006, the first 60m & 1575-ton box beam of IV-E contract section ,Jintang Bridge was succesfully precasted.

form

On October 22th,2006, the first concrete casting gets a successful performance on the jobsite of ShiTai(Shijiazhuang-Tai yuan) intercity passenger special line (contractor: Bureau No.22, CRCC). The MSS entire hydraulic inner form used on this project was made by SANBO.

For the time being, the inner form of MSS is usually formed by segmentations at home and abroad. It is the first time that moving in and out the form as a whole on a 32m-long beam in the world. The MSS, on a finished pier, can perform a piece of beam casting through a series of working procedures .The processes goes as follows: template adjustment -- reinforced lashing -- concrete pouring -- curing -- inner form removing--tensioning--outer form removing.

It is light in weight, full-hydraulic synchronizer in control, reliable in system characters, well-driven by synchronizer, reasonable in structure. It works automatically by hydraulic system. The effect of the concrete after removing the form is quite good. It can save 30% of time.

Shield lining segment

The shield lining segments are used on the digged subway tunnels after assembled. Six pieces will make a round circle. It protects the finished subway tunnels from collapse.The surface of segment is smooth and appears in offwhite.
